Follow these steps to set up a videoconference with one or more remote sites.
- Get in touch with your remote site(s) by phone or e-mail and establish a date on which you'd like to set up a videoconference.
- Seven days before the target date for your videoconference, send an e-mail
to video@alaska.edu (preferred) or
call Video Conferencing Services at 450-8390 (or 1-800-910-9601). Provide
the following information:
- Event Contact Person: (include an email address/phone number)
- Event Moderator: (include an email address/phone number)
- Event Name:
- Event Date(s):
- Event Start/End Time:
- Primary Event Location: (include campus, building name and room number where applicable)
- Connecting Locations: (include campuses, building names and room numbers where applicable)
- Sponsoring MAU:
- Administrative or Academic Event?:
- VCS will make the arrangements for the conference, including contacting remote sites, arranging for rooms for remote participants, and setting up the calls from various locations.
- Show up at your site 5-10 minutes earlier than your scheduled start time. Hit the OK button on the Tandberg remote to wake up the monitor(s). The conference will start automatically at the specified time.
- At OUP, turn on the overhead projector with the remote.
- Make sure that you have the following
items ready and tested if you plan to use any of them during your videoconference:
- Your laptop is hooked up to the overhead projector at OUP or to the Tandberg codec in Gruening
- Your laptop is hooked up to the SMART Board at OUP
- DVDs or VHS tapes are inserted into the player and the player is on
- When you first connect, your local mic may be muted. Click the yellow Mic Off button on the Tandberg remote to unmute the mic when you are ready to begin speaking.
- When your conference is over, click the red Hang Up button on the Tandberg remote. Do NOT turn off the plasma monitor or the Tandberg camera. They will go into sleep mode by themselves after a while.
- If you were using the overhead projector/SMART Board at OUP, make sure and turn it off.
Call VCS at (907) 450-8390 (or 1-800-910-9601) during your conference if you run into any problems. There is always a technician there during a scheduled conference.
